English

Noun

profiling (usually uncountable, plural profilings)

  1. The forensic science of constructing an outline of a person's individual characteristics.
  2. (military, historical) In the construction of fieldworks, the erection at proper intervals of wooden profiles, to show to the workmen the sectional form of the parapets at those points.
